Pediatric Mental Health Care Access Program Fact Sheet
On January 10, 2019, the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services' (HHS') Health Resources and Services Administration (HRSA) published this fact sheet regarding the Pediatric Mental Health Care Access Program ((PMHCA). The PMHCA promotes behavioral health integration into pediatric primary care using telehealth. State or regional networks of pediatric mental health teams provide tele-consultation, training, technical assistance, and care coordination for pediatric primary care providers to diagnose, treat and refer children with behavioral health conditions.
